I am a beginning programmer and I am trying to use EXIF to get the 
"Image DateTime" from my .jpg files for a little program I am writing 
that makes web pages for my family photos.

I am trying to use EXIF.py by Gene Cash. He also has written 
exiftool.py, and both of these files are available here:

http://home.cfl.rr.com/genecash/digital_camera.html

Just messing around at the interpreter I do something like this and get 
what appears to be an empty dictionary.

import EXIF, os
file = open('temp.jpg')
data = EXIF.process_file(file)
print data
 >>>
{}

I thought that would dump the same data I get at the command prompt when 
I do:

exiftool.py -v temp.jpg

but I must be way off. If someone can offer me a pointer I would really 
appreciate it!
